Beloved rose or bitter rose
A modern compound name blending Mia and Rose. Mia is often derived from the Hebrew 'Miriam' meaning 'bitter' or the Latin 'meus' meaning 'mine', while Rose refers to the fragrant flower. Together, it represents a cherished or beloved floral symbol.
Less common today
Miarose isn't in the latest US Top 1000. It last peaked at #3,690 in 2017.
